What is 20kVA PD Gas type Transformer?

 

The 20kVA Partial Discharge (PD) Gas-Insulated Test Transformer is a specialized device designed for high-voltage testing. It delivers a stable high voltage while exhibiting extremely low partial discharge levels. Featuring a gas-insulated design, it is suitable for precision insulation testing applications.

1. 20kVA (Capacity)

Indicates that the device has a rated capacity of 20 kVA.

Determines the device's voltage and current output capabilities.

Suitable for medium- and high-voltage testing applications.

 

2. Partial Discharge (PD)

Refers to minute discharge phenomena within insulation.

Key features of this device include: extremely low background partial discharge (typically ≤5 pC).

This ensures no interference with test results, guaranteeing detection accuracy.

 

3. Gas-Type

Uses gas as the insulating medium (e.g., SF₆ or dry air)

Compared to oil-immersed types:

No oil contamination or risk of leakage

More stable insulation performance

More suitable for partial discharge testing environments

 

 

II. Main Applications

 

Widely used for testing the insulation performance of high-voltage equipment, including:

 

  • Power cables (e.g., XLPE cables)
  • Transformers, bushings
  • Switchgear, GIS equipment
  • Partial discharge testing systems
  • Power testing laboratories and inspection agencies
